OneMain Financial (NYSE: OMF) is the leader in offering nonprime customers responsible access to credit and is dedicated to improving the financial well-being of hardworking Americans. Since 1912, we've looked beyond credit scores to help people get the money they need today and reach their goals for tomorrow. Our growing suite of personal loans, credit cards and other products help people borrow better and work toward a brighter future.
In our more than 1,300 community branches and across the U.S., team members help millions of customers solve critical financial needs, including debt consolidation, home and auto repairs, medical procedures and extending household budgets. We meet customers where they want to be -- in person, by phone and online.

The Maintenance Person assists management in achieving and maintaining outstanding interior and exterior restaurant cleanliness and maintaining restaurant equipment. As a member of the Maintenance Team, your restaurant will support you with the tools and training needed to succeed.

The Maintenance Person's responsibilities may include, but are not limited to:

  • Filtering oil fryers daily
  • Maintaining outside grounds
  • Clean equipment, inside and outside windows, stock rooms and restrooms
  • Unload delivery truck 2 times a week
  • Take out and empty trash compactor
  • Change light bulbs
  • Clean HVAC/Exhaust units and roof of debris
